Chapter Nine
Sabrina had noticed the man earlier. Judging from his camera, he was likely a reporter. She knew this was going to happen, part of her role to draw attention and funds to Boxwood. She didnât mind after having dealt with actual, uninvited transgressions.
âThis was beautiful,â she said to Misty as they walked along the stands of the Christmas market, admiring glass and wood creations.
âIt is. At least no one can take that away from Boxwood.â
âWhat do you mean?â
âLori heard that our investor is coming to town. Weâre not sure why. He hasnât been around much since we all signed the contract.â Misty shrugged. âIt might not mean anything, but I think he put in that money on a whim. Perhaps he didnât know what to realistically expect from a town like Boxwood. He could take it away again.â
He was about toâ¦So Donovan hadnât talked to her yet, and she didnât even know he was already in town. Why? What was his deal? Sabrina couldnât imagine he didnât know what he had gotten himself into. After all, heâd grown up in Boxwood too.
âWould that be such a horrible thing in the long run?â Sabrina cringed at the surprise in Mistyâs expression. âI mean you said it yourself. No one knows whatâs going to happen once the train stops running, right?â
âSure, but thatâs not a reason to give up. Besides, Lori and I have put everything into this. Our lives are here. We have nothing to fall back on.â
There might have been a small jibe in that sentence, but Mistyâs tone didnât reflect it, so Sabrina decided not to dwell. In fact, she had an idea. Sheâd have to talk to Ethan again before she could share it with Mistyâ¦but it might just work if he wasnât interested in maintaining a small-town business. There was a chance each of them could get out of it what they hoped for.
âYouâd just need another investor instead,â she suggested.
âYou say that like itâs an easy thing to achieve.â
âI donât know, it might be. Letâs focus on the train for a momentâ¦The booth at the tree lighting raised more money than we imagined.â
âYes, butâ¦â
âWe have to find a way to come up with more. If we can save the train, we wonât have to worry about the inn.â
âWe,â Misty repeated, sounding pensive and hopeful.
âYes, we. Iâm all in, remember?â
Sabrina hadnât expected Mistyâs arms around her the next moment, but she didnât mind, grateful they were on the same page. For the most part, anyway. She held on, remembering the moment on the ice rink once more. Some difficult conversations still lay ahead, but she felt a little more confident about handling them. She couldnât wait for the next time they were alone together, a moment when they wouldnât have to talk business or raising money.
By Christmas, at the latest.
All in.
âThere you are.â Loriâs voice startled them apart. âWhoâs ready for some mulled wine?â
